Continue ReadingThere was a lot of great football in Cincinnati during week 9 this weekend. Here are five players from Cincy who have earned a game ball for their outstanding performance this week.
Jaxon Schreiber
Jaxon Schreiber
The Senior QB played well on Friday night as he completed 16 of 22 passes for 122 yds and a TD while rushing for 41 yds on 10 carries (4.1 ypc) as he led Oak Hills to a 13-10 victory over Lakota East to improve to 4-5 on the season. He does a good job of reading the defense and steps into his throw releasing the ball with good accuracy and arms strength on short, intermediate and deep passes. He shows great mobility as he avoids the rush and delivers an accurate ball while on the move. He exhibits good play speed as he is able to pick up a 1st down on his own while running the ball.
Jake Bates
Jake Bates
The Senior LB played very well on Friday night as he made a key interception and helped Mason defeat Fairfield 30-7 and improve to 7-2 on the season. He plays as an OLB. Against the run, he quickly reads run/pass, shows good closing speed in pursuit while playing with good leverage before delivering a big hit preventing a gain of significant yardage. Against the pass, he locates the ball in the air and shows good hands as he comes down with the interception.
Justin Re
Justin Re
Justin had a big game on Friday night as he caught 2 touchdown passes and helped Elder defeat Bishop Chatard from Indianapolis 21-16 to improve to 7-2 on the season. He plays as a slot WR and on the outside. He is a great route runner who shows good play speed as he gets behind the DB. He tracks the ball well in the air before making a nice catch. He shows good athleticism as he outruns defenders on a long touchdown reception.
Josiah Payne
Josiah Payne
Josiah had a huge game on Friday night as he rushed for 250 yds on 32 carries (7.8 ypc) as he helped Chaminade Julienne defeat Archbishop McNicholas 36-29 and improve to 5-4 on the season. He shows good vision as he finds the open hole with good burst as he gets through the hole quickly. He plays with very good contact balance as he breaks tackles from LB and DB with ease. He plays with good competitive toughness as he is reliable in the red zone with the ball in his hands as he scores a TD.
Carson Cheek
Carson Cheek
Carson played a big role in Badin’s 14-6 defeat of Bishop Fenwick on Friday night. He returned a fumble 42 yards for a TD that sealed the win and enabled Badin to remain undefeated at 9-0. He plays as a FS. Against the pass, he quickly keys and diagnoses the play, shows good closing speed in pursuit and delivers a big hit to the receiver preventing a gain of significant yardage. Against the run, he squares his shoulders and delivers a nice form tackle preventing a potential touchdown.
